Output f8a6dd1fdf61813a335b3d63d0953eafb92bc410637c17dc04f6f8cdc6df2ea7:0

value
85000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b967f9eb7085f955c172db26a2e0927d3ff22591 OP_EQUAL
address
3JbMVRpjMah73HBxv4QkzUNwPWUbdCB78n
transaction
f8a6dd1fdf61813a335b3d63d0953eafb92bc410637c17dc04f6f8cdc6df2ea7
confirmations
506240
spent
true